2. The Data We Collect About You


Personal data, or personal information, means any information about an individual from which that person can be identified. It does not include data where the identity has been removed (anonymous data).


We may collect, use, store and transfer different kinds of personal data about you which we have grouped together as follows:

• Identity Data includes first name, maiden name, last name, username or similar identifier, marital status, title, date of birth and gender.

• Contact Data includes billing address, delivery address, email address and telephone numbers.

• Financial Data includes bank account and payment card details.

• Transaction Data includes details about payments to and from you and other details of products and services you have purchased from us.

• Technical Data includes internet protocol (IP) address, your login data, browser type and version, time zone setting and location, browser plug-in types and versions, operating system and platform, and other technology on the devices you use to access this website.

• Profile Data includes your username and password, purchases or orders made by you, your interests, preferences, feedback and survey responses.

• Usage Data includes information about how you use our website, products and services.

• Marketing and Communications Data includes your preferences in receiving marketing from us and our third parties and your communication preferences.



We also collect, use and share Aggregated Data such as statistical or demographic data for any purpose. Aggregated Data could be derived from your personal data but is not considered personal data in law as this data will not directly or indirectly reveal your identity. For example, we may aggregate your Usage Data to calculate the percentage of users accessing a specific website feature. However, if we combine or connect Aggregated Data with your personal data so that it can directly or indirectly identify you, we treat the combined data as personal data which will be used in accordance with this privacy policy.

We do not collect any Special Categories of Personal Data about you (this includes details about your race or ethnicity, religious or philosophical beliefs, sex life, sexual orientation, political opinions, trade union membership, information about your health, and genetic and biometric data). Nor do we collect any information about criminal convictions and offences.

10. Your rights


To determine the appropriate retention period for personal data, we consider the amount, nature, and sensitivity of the personal data, the potential risk of harm from unauthorised use or disclosure of your personal data, the purposes for which we process your personal data and whether we can achieve those purposes through other means, and the applicable legal requirements. if you would like more information on our retention periods then please do get in contact info@queensbridgehomes.co.uk

Deletion of personal data “Right to be forgotten”

It is your right to request the deletion of your personal data from our records. This enables you to ask us to delete or remove personal data where there is no good reason for us continuing to process it. You also have the right to ask us to delete or remove your personal data where you have successfully exercised your right to object to processing (see below), where we may have processed your information unlawfully or where we are required to erase your personal data to comply with local law. Note, however, that we may not always be able to comply with your request of deletion for specific legal reasons which will be notified to you, if applicable, at the time of your request. for example if it is necessary for us to perform our legal obligations or contractual obligations to you or another third party.

Object to processing

Where we are relying on a legitimate interest as the legal basis for processing your personal data and there is something about your particular situation which makes you want to object to processing on this ground as you feel it impacts on your fundamental rights and freedoms.

You also have the right to object where we are processing your personal data for direct marketing purposes. In some cases, we may demonstrate that we have compelling legitimate grounds to process your information which override your rights and freedoms.

Keeping your details accurate

You have the right to ask us to rectify any personal data we hold about you which is inaccurate or incomplete. We may need to verify the accuracy of the new data you provide to us.

Restriction of processing

You have the right to ask us to suspend the processing of your personal data in the following scenarios: (a) if you want us to establish the data's accuracy; (b) where our use of the data is unlawful but you do not want us to erase it; (c) where you need us to hold the data even if we no longer require it as you need it to establish, exercise or defend legal claims; or (d) you have objected to our use of your data but we need to verify whether we have overriding legitimate grounds to use it.

Transfer of data

Where you have provided us with automated information which you initially consented for us to use to perform a contract with you can ask us to transfer your personal data to a third party. We will transfer this personal data in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format.

Withdraw consent

Where we are relying on consent as the legal basis to process your personal data you have the right to withdraw that consent at any time. However, this will not affect the lawfulness of any processing carried out before you withdraw your consent. If you withdraw your consent, we may not be able to provide certain services to you. We will advise you if this is the case at the time you withdraw your consent.

11. Finding out what personal information we hold.


In addition to the rights set out above, you have the right to request a copy of any personal information we hold about you and to have any inaccuracies corrected, this is commonly known as a "subject access request".

We may require you to prove your identity (with two documents of approved identification) before searching our records. At the present time, the information will be provided to you within one month of whichever of the following comes last:

The date of submission of your request.

Establishment of your identity.

Identification that we accept

The following are examples of the type of identification that we can accept in order to process your information request:

Passport.

Driving licence.

Birth or marriage certificate.

Utility bill (from the past 3 months).

Current vehicle registration document.

Bank statement (from the past 3 months).

Rent book or similar tenancy agreement (that covers the past 3 months).

Please note, if we have previously established your identity and it matches the information you provide, this may be sufficient for the purposes of actioning your request. If you have not previously provided us with identification, then we may require you to provide copy documentation of the examples listed above in order to process your request.

No fee usually required

You will not have to pay a fee to access your personal data (or to exercise any of the other rights). However, we may charge a reasonable fee if your request is clearly unfounded, repetitive or excessive. Alternatively, we may refuse to comply with your request in these circumstances.

Time limit to respond

We try to respond to all legitimate requests within one month. Occasionally it may take us longer than a month if your request is particularly complex or you have made a number of requests. In this case, we will notify you and keep you updated.

13. Web browser cookies.


What is a cookie?

A cookie contains a small amount of data and (typically) a unique identifier. When you access any of our websites or platforms (or those of third-party providers) a cookie will be sent to your device. The cookie records information about your online preferences and therefore allows us to tailor our websites and any contact with you to your specific interests.

Why do we use cookies?

The information we obtain by monitoring all visits to our websites enables us to improve, through anonymous analysis, our services to our customers and visitors.

Many websites use cookies in order to see whether a device has visited the website before. Any repeat visit is verified by finding the cookie left previously. By using cookies in this way, we can provide a better and more personal user experience. It also enables us to recognise whether you have already signed up to receive information from us – thus avoiding duplication.

Your web browser may also provide us with information concerning your device, such as an IP address or details about the browser you are using. For example, if you are looking at a specific location or property, we may use your location to ensure that any web pages or communications are tailored to you (this feature is coming soon to the site).

Please note, you are able to change your cookies settings to control access to any device you are using.
